Birthday gift dilemma

Yesterday was my brother's 24th birthday, and today is my best friend Iliana's 26th birthday. I love birthdays, because it's a celebration of the birth of a loved one... and of another year having the person in your life.

But every time someone's birthday comes around, I get caught in the worst cracking-of-the-brain trying to come up with a meaningful present to give. This is especially so for those whom I've known for very very long, and whom I love very much. For me, every time I give something to someone I treasure, I want it to be something meaningful and useful. Not just some random marketing-gimmick mug or picture frame.

Sometimes, I will know in advance what to get someone, either because there's something they obviously need and can't afford/don't manage to get around buying it themselves, or because they straight-out mention it's something they want as a gift (which I prefer! Makes my job in present-hunting easier :D), or I stumble upon something that I know will light up their day. Other times however, as in the case of Izhar and Iliana this year... I'm left clueless. They both tell me there's nothing they need or want, and that's not helping!

A number of my close friends can attest to getting their presents months -sometimes even close to a year- later. That's what I usually resort to.. not buying someone anything, until I find the perfect gift. And finding the perfect gift for the perfect person every year is not an easy task!

But then again, I also like to randomly buy gifts or treats for my loved ones for no reason. Things that I know they'd love. So hopefully, that makes up for my inability to find birthday presents in a timely manner!
